Bihar Assembly Elections LIVE Updates: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Home Minister Amit Shah are scheduled to address public rallies across Bihar today (Monday). While the prime minister will hold rallies in Saharsa and in Katihar districts, Shah will take part in rallies in Sheohar, Sitamarhi and Madhubani during the day. Congress President Mallikarjun Kharge will also address a rally in Vaishali. Congress general secretary Priyanka Gandhi Vadra will also address two poll rallies at Sonbarsa and Lakhisarai, and hold a roadshow at Rosera.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ath is also scheduled to address four public rallies in Patna, Saran and Muzaffarpur.

PM Modi Patna roadshow: Prime Minister Narendra Modi led a mega roadshow in Patna on Sunday evening, accompanied by Union minister Rajiv Ranjan Singh ‘Lalan’ of the JD(U), state BJP president Dilip Jaiswal and Patna Sahib MP Ravi Shankar Prasad. Modi began the roadshow from Dinkar Golambar. Before that, Modi Sunday took a swipe at the Congress leadership, saying that while blasts were taking place in Pakistan during Operation Sindoor, the Congress’s first family was losing sleep in India.

Manifesto: The Opposition’s manifesto for the upcoming assembly election promises government jobs and financial aid for women. It includes legislation to guarantee a job for one member of each family within 20 days of forming a government, 200 units of free electricity, and a monthly aid of ₹2,500 for women. The document lists 25 key points and also promises the implementation of the Old Pension Scheme. Meanwhile, the NDA’s manifesto pledges jobs for one crore youth, the creation of one crore ‘Lakhpati Didis’, the introduction of metro train services in four additional cities, and the establishment of seven international airports in the state, among other initiatives.
